> Thanks, in my ignorance I assumed that xiph.org would be the proper
> place to look for specs.  Is this OGM format some unofficial thing,
> not supported by xiph?
>

Yes, I believe it's a hack to add video support to ogg streams before the  
theora project got it together, hence "ogg multimedia" rather than ogg  
vorbis / ogg theora.
